The numbers below refer to the step number on the diagnostic table.
- 2: This step tests if the malfunction exists in the vehicles charging system.
- 3: This step tests if the malfunction is intermittent.

| 3 | With a scan tool, observe the Battery Voltage parameter in the electric power steering (EPS) Data List 1. Does the scan tool display 9.55-17.5 volts? |
Go to Diagnostic Aids | Go to Step 4 |
| 4 | Test the battery positive voltage circuit of the power steering control module (PSCM) for a high resistance. Refer to Circuit Testing
and to Wiring Repairs
. Did you find and correct the condition? |
Go to Step 10 | Go to Step 5 |
| 5 | Test the ground circuit of the PSCM for a high resistance. Refer to Circuit Testing
and Wiring Repairs
. Did you find and correct the condition? |
Go to Step 10 | Go to Step 6 |
| 6 | Inspect for poor connections at the harness connector of the underhood fuse block stud terminal. Refer to Testing for Intermittent Conditions and Poor Connections
and to Connector Repairs
. Did you find and correct the condition? |
Go to Step 10 | Go to Step 7 |
| 7 | Inspect for poor connections at the harness connector of the PSCM. Refer to Testing for Intermittent Conditions and Poor Connections
and to Connector Repairs
. Did you find and correct the condition? |
Go to Step 10 | Go to Step 8 |
| 8 | Inspect for poor connections at the ground terminal G109. Refer to Testing for Intermittent Conditions and Poor Connections
and to Connector Repairs
. Did you find and correct the condition? |
Go to Step 10 | Go to Step 9 |
| 9 | Replace the EPS assembly. Refer to Steering Column Replacement
. Did you complete the replacement? |
Go to Step 10 | - |
